A Jukebox with a Country Song, released in November 1991, is a chart-topping single by American country artist Doug Stone from his album *I Thought It Was You*. Written by Gene Nelson and Ronnie Samoset, and produced by Doug Johnson, the song narrates the story of a man seeking solace in his favorite bar after an argument with his wife, only to find it transformed into an upscale establishment, leaving him feeling out of place. The track resonated with audiences, becoming Stone’s second number-one hit on the country charts in both the United States and Canada. The accompanying music video, directed by Peter Lippman, visually captures the song’s themes of change and nostalgia.
